"Capturing the Essence of Correspondence: A Journey Through Time" In a world where instant messaging dominates, let us take a moment to appreciate the beauty and significance of correspondence. From handwritten letters to heartfelt greetings cards, these artifacts hold stories that transcend time. "The Letter" by Rex Whistler transports us back to the 20th century, reminding us of an era when words were carefully crafted on paper. It speaks volumes about the emotions conveyed through ink strokes and delicate penmanship. The old mailbox at Lincoln post office in Lincoln, New Mexico stands as a testament to countless exchanges between loved ones separated by distance. Each letter dropped within its metal embrace carried hopes, dreams, and connections waiting to be rekindled. Page 2 of Abigail Adams' letter to John Adams from 1776 showcases her eloquence in expressing her thoughts during a pivotal period in history. This ink-stained piece holds glimpses into their intimate conversations amidst revolutionary times. A WW2 greetings card sent by Corporal Joan Pearson reminds us of the power of connection even during times of conflict. These small tokens held immense value for soldiers far away from home, offering solace and support amidst chaos. John Hampden's letter to Colonel Bulstrode after the Battle of Edgehill takes us back even further - all the way to 1642. The artist himself captures this historical moment with his own hand; it is both a personal account and an artistic masterpiece. Frederick Childe Hassam's "The Writing Desk" immerses us in 1915 America - an era marked by elegance and sophistication. This painting depicts not just a desk but also serves as a window into an entire culture built upon written communication. Arabella Stuart's letter to Countess Shrewsbury provides insight into aristocratic life during the late 16th-early 17th century. Frederick George Netherclift brings this exchange alive through his artistic interpretation, allowing us to glimpse into their world.
